+ * Support added for ripping with the GNU Compact Disc
+ Input and Control library (libcdio) as requested by
+ both gentoo and NixOS. The utility used is cd-paranoia
+ and can best be called from a conf file as follows:
+
+ CDROMREADERSYNTAX=libcdio
+ CD_PARANOIA=cd-paranoia
+ CDPARANOIAOPTS="--never-skip=40 --verbose"
+
+ with the CD_PARANOIA variable giving the correct path
+ to cd-paranoia. I believe that cd-paranoia uses the same
+ options as cdparanoia but if I am proven incorrect this
+ will need to be rectified...

+ * New variables for m4a/aac encoding options to be
+ manipulated in a users ~/.abcde.conf file:
+ 1. FAACENCOPTS for faac encoding options
+ 2. NEROAACENCOPTS for neroAacEnc options
+ 3. FDKAACENCOPTS for fdkaacenc options
+ Note that these options replace the now obsolete AACENCOPTS.
